Professional Background
Rosina Tong is a distinguished educational leader with a wealth of experience spanning various roles within the San Francisco Unified School District (SFUSD). Her journey in education began as a bilingual teacher, where she laid the groundwork for her deep understanding of student needs within diverse communities. Rosina's ability to connect with students, families, and teachers has been integral to her success in creating inclusive educational environments.
Prior to her current role as the principal of Sunset Elementary School, Rosina made significant contributions as an elementary school principal within the SFUSD. During her tenure, she focused on fostering strong relationships within the school community, emphasizing the importance of collaboration between educators and families. As the Executive Director of the Educational Placement Center, Rosina utilized her leadership skills to guide families through the enrollment process, ensuring that students are placed in environments that best meet their educational and personal needs.
Throughout her career, she has prioritized anti-racism and social justice, implementing initiatives that promote equity in education. Rosina's commitment to these principles is reflected in her daily interactions with all stakeholders, as she strives to ensure that everyone has the resources and support necessary for success.
Education and Achievements
Rosina's academic journey has provided her with a strong foundation for her influential career. She earned her Master of Arts in Education from the University of San Francisco, where she honed her skills in educational leadership and pedagogy. Her educational background is complemented by a Multiple Subject Teaching Credential, with a focus on Chinese Bilingual Cross-Cultural Education, obtained from San Francisco State University. This unique combination of education allows her to adeptly address the needs of diverse learners, particularly in bilingual settings.
Rosina's undergraduate studies culminated in a Bachelor of Arts in Social Sciences from the University of California, Berkeley, where she developed a thorough understanding of societal dynamics that impact education. This foundation underscores her commitment to social justice and equity, as she works to create schools that honor and uplift every student.
